Which side of the plane to sit from Penang International Airport (Penang) to Don Mueang International Airport (Bangkok)?
Left Side of the Plane
The left side offers spectacular views of the Andaman Sea coastline, the narrow Isthmus of Kra, and the unique salt evaporation ponds as you descend into the Bangkok outskirts.
Langkawi Archipelago
Shortly after takeoff, look for the emerald islands of Langkawi scattered across the Andaman Sea.
Isthmus of Kra
The narrowest part of the Malay Peninsula, where you can see the land bridge connecting Thailand and Malaysia.
Khao Sam Roi Yot
Dramatic limestone peaks rising sharply from the coastal marshes of the Gulf of Thailand.
Samut Sakhon Salt Pans
Intricate geometric patterns of salt farms and shrimp ponds visible during the final descent into Bangkok.
Choose an afternoon flight for the best lighting on the Andaman coastline without the direct morning glare. During the final approach, keep your camera ready for the coastal wetlands which provide vibrant colors and textures from above.
Penang Bridges
An immediate view of both the Sultan Abdul Halim Muadzam Shah Bridge and the original Penang Bridge upon takeoff.
Tenasserim Hills
The lush, jungle-clad mountain range that forms a natural border between Thailand and Myanmar.
Hua Hin Coastline
Clear views of the popular resort town's long sandy beaches and coastal developments.
Bangkok City Center
Depending on the landing pattern, you may see the dense urban sprawl, skyscrapers, and the Chao Phraya River.
The right side is ideal for night flights to witness the massive, glowing urban sprawl of the Bangkok metropolitan area. On departure, sit here to see the entirety of Penang Island and the bustling Port of George Town.
